Comprehending Irrigation: Methods and Benefits

Irrigation plays a crucial role in agriculture by delivering water to crops. There are various methods of irrigation, each with its specific advantages and drawbacks. Some common techniques include basin irrigation, where water floods over the entire field; trickle irrigation, which directs water directly to the plant roots; and sprinkler irrigation, where water is applied through the air.

Each irrigation technique has its own benefits. For for example, trickle irrigation is highly efficient as it minimizes water loss. Basin irrigation can be a cost-effective choice for large fields, while overhead irrigation is suitable for diverse types of crops.

The benefits of irrigation are manifold. It improves crop yields by providing a consistent water supply, even during dry periods. Irrigation also enables the cultivation of crops in areas with low rainfall or where water is scarce. Moreover, irrigation can upgrade soil fertility by leaching out salts and providing a suitable environment for plant growth.
